Cassandra Profita is an experienced environment reporter and producer currently working at Oregon Public Broadcasting since August 2010. Prior to this role, Cassandra contributed to the East Oregonian Publishing as a business and environment reporter from 2006 to 2010 and was a member of the Society of Environmental Journalists from 2006 to 2017. An internship at the National Geographic Society occurred in 2002. Academic qualifications include a Master’s Degree in Multimedia Journalism from the University of Oregon Graduate School (2016-2018) and a Bachelor of Journalism in Journalism and Environmental Studies from the University of Missouri-Columbia (1999-2003).
